Big Screen DS!


"Here's a little project I've been working on. It's a Nintendo DS hooked up to 2 Tablet PC screens, using an FPGA in between to do some translation magic. Pen input from the Tablet PC screens is sent back to the DS. It can also dump screenshots to a PC via serial port." This is ridiculously awesome!

Magnum Chrome DS Shell


The Magnum Chrome DS case is a mod for your Nintendo DS. Completely replacing the outer shell of your portable, the Magnum is actually covered in chrome, not some spray-on finish. This means your DS will be tougher and more resistant to those smudges. However, this is only an outer shell so you may need to pick up an inner shell too for the full transformation is don't have a black DS. The shell goes for about $40.
